The stock market is a financial marketplace where stocks, or shares of ownership in a company, are bought and sold. It is one of the most important parts of the global economy, as it allows companies to raise capital by selling shares of ownership, and it allows individuals and institutions to invest in those companies and potentially earn a return on their investment.
There are two main types of stock markets: primary and secondary. In a primary market, new shares of stock are issued by a company and sold to the public for the first time. This is typically done through an initial public offering (IPO). In a secondary market, existing shares of stock are bought and sold among investors. This is what most people think of when they hear the term “stock market.”
The stock market is often divided into different sections, known as exchanges. The most well-known exchange in the United States is the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E), but there are also other exchanges such as the NASDAQ and the American Stock Exchange (AMEX). Each exchange has its own set of rules and regulations, and the companies that are listed on them must meet certain requirements.
One of the most important things to understand about the stock market is that it is highly volatile. The value of a stock can go up or down very quickly and dramatically, based on a variety of factors such as the performance of the company, the overall state of the economy, and investor sentiment. This volatility can create both opportunities and risks for investors.
When an investor buys a stock, they are essentially buying a small piece of ownership in a company. As the company grows and becomes more successful, the value of the stock will typically increase, allowing the investor to earn a return on their investment. However, if the company does not perform well or if the overall market conditions are unfavorable, the value of the stock may decrease, potentially resulting in a loss for the investor.
There are many different strategies that investors can use when investing in the stock market. Some people prefer to buy and hold stocks for the long-term, hoping to benefit from the growth of the company over time. Others prefer to trade stocks more frequently, trying to take advantage of short-term price movements. There are also various investment vehicles such as mutual funds and exchange-traded funds (ETFs) that allow investors to gain exposure to the stock market without having to buy individual stocks.
Another important aspect of the stock market is market analysis. There are many tools and techniques that investors can use to try to predict future stock prices and market trends. One popular method is technical analysis, which looks at past price and volume data to try to identify patterns that may indicate future movements. Another method is fundamental analysis, which looks at factors such as a company’s financial performance, management, and industry trends to try to predict future performance.

Additionally, there are several different types of stock market participants, each playing a unique role in the market. These include retail investors, institutional investors, and market makers. Retail investors are individuals who buy and sell stocks for their own personal account. Institutional investors are large organizations such as mutual funds, pension funds, and insurance companies that invest on behalf of their clients. Market makers are firms or individuals that act as intermediaries, buying and selling stocks to ensure that there is always a buyer and a seller for each stock.
Another important concept in the stock market is the concept of index. An index is a collection of stocks that represent a particular market or segment of the market. The most well-known index in the U.S is the S&P 500, which is a collection of 500 large-cap stocks that represent the overall performance of the U.S stock market. Other popular indexes include the Dow Jones Industrial Average, NASDAQ composite, and the Russell 2000.
The stock market also has an impact on the overall economy as well. When the stock market is doing well, it can indicate that the economy is also doing well. Consumer confidence tends to be higher, which can lead to increased spending and economic growth. On the other hand, when the stock market is performing poorly, it can be a sign of economic trouble. This can lead to decreased spending and a potential recession.
In recent years, there has been an increasing interest in socially responsible investing (SRI) which is an investment strategy that considers both financial return and social and environmental impact. This approach involves investing in companies that are committed to environmental, social, and governance (ESG) principles. By investing in companies that are committed to these principles, investors can align their values with their investments, and support companies that are working to make a positive impact on the world.

What are the 4 types of stocks?
Common Stock: This is the most common type of stock and represents ownership in a company. Common stockholders have the right to vote on company matters and receive dividends, if the company pays them.
Preferred Stock: Preferred stockholders have a higher claim on the company’s assets and earnings than common stockholders. They may also receive a fixed dividend that is paid before common stock dividends.
Penny Stocks: These are stocks that trade for less than $5 per share and are typically issued by small, unproven companies. They are considered to be high-risk investments.
Blue-Chip Stocks: These are stocks of well-established, financially stable companies with a history of consistent earnings and dividends. They are considered to be low-risk investments and are often included in major stock market indices.
How to invest in stock market?
Research: Before investing in the stock market, research different companies and industries to gain a better understanding of their financial performance and potential for growth. Look at a company’s financial statements, annual reports, and analyst ratings to determine if it is a good investment opportunity.
Set investment goals: Determine what you want to achieve with your investment, whether it be short-term gains or long-term growth. This will help you determine how much risk you are willing to take on.
Open a brokerage account: To invest in the stock market, you will need to open a brokerage account. There are many online brokerage firms that offer easy and convenient ways to invest in the stock market.
Choose your stocks: Once you have opened a brokerage account, you can begin selecting stocks to invest in. Consider diversifying your portfolio by investing in different industries and companies to minimize risk.
Monitor your investments: Keep an eye on the performance of your investments and make adjustments as necessary. This includes regularly checking stock prices, dividends, and financial statements.
Have patience: Investing in the stock market takes time and patience. Don’t get discouraged by short-term fluctuations, and remember that the stock market is a long-term investment.
Consult with a financial advisor: If you’re unsure about how to invest in the stock market, consider consulting with a financial advisor who can guide you through the process and help you make informed decisions.
